The Thoughts Behind Casino Layouts

Casino layouts use deep mind tricks to shape how guests act and keep them playing.

The clever twisting paths get rid of straight walks and clear views, making it hard to know where you are. This tricks you into staying longer and playing more.

Smart Game Spots and Air Control

  • Big games sit in the center, while slot games line the main pathways to catch quick players.
  • The wise use of no windows and less natural light helps players forget time, keeping them playing longer.
  • Ceiling heights gently guide people, with low ceilings for close spots and high ceilings leading to big areas.

Moving and Finding Your Way

Casino layouts rely much on smart move systems to pull in interest and more money. Round paths and well-placed game spots make an easy flow.

Top-pulling slot machines and nice table games take key spots along the main paths, with food and seats deeper in.

Deep Move Brains

The known twist effect is a base in modern casino design, brings in curved paths over straight routes to add to the fun of finding while subtly guiding.

Limited view spots make for surprise finds, while build parts like support beams, changing roof heights, and smart walls divide the floor into clear game zones.

Right Movement Patterns

Lefthand circles play on how most folks tend to move left through areas.
